Access Services Minutes - June 18, 2024

Welcome: Tricia called the meeting to order.

Summer Reading Check In (Emily Williams and Kristin Williamson, OES) 15,000 people signed up, on the way to 20-22k, already have 28% of the points required for Read It Forward, Kristin and Emily have been going around to all the libraries to help. 268 teen volunteers this year. This year’s Read it Forward organization is the Latino Development Agency. Read the Engagement Cabinet minutes to learn more. Kristin extended thanks to everyone for their hard work

Access Services Minutes - October 17, 2023

Welcome: Tricia called the meeting to order.

Learn: CARL.Connect Training (Tricia Andrews): Tricia provided an overview of the CARL.Connect Test environment and recommended practicing functionality in CARL.Connect Test. The last data refresh was October 25, 2022, so newer employees will not have a login. However, Tricia can provide generic logins for them upon request. Highlights from the training included the use of item grid, holds expired, and account management.
